All Inclusive
best 4* in varadero

event 3 - 90 nights, All Inclusive
flight_takeoff Toronto, Montreal, Vancouver, Calgary, Edmonton, Ottawa, Winnipeg
event 3 - 90 nights, All Inclusive
flight_takeoff Toronto, Montreal, Vancouver, Calgary, Edmonton, Ottawa, Winnipeg